The California state government is a vibrant entity responsible for governing the diverse interests of its citizens. Established in 1850, California's political system is characterized by a strong separation of powers.
The state's charter outlines the design of government, establishing the roles and responsibilities of the executive, legislative, and judicial branches.
- Guiding is the Governor, who serves as the chief administrator and supervises various state agencies.
- The Legislature, made up of the Assembly and Senate, passes laws that impact daily life in California.
- Moreover, the state's judicial branch ensures the impartial application of law through its courts.
California's civic landscape is ever-changing, with a wide range of groups and views contributing the policy cycle.

California Economy: Innovation, Challenges, and Opportunities
California's economy is a dynamic force, fueled by persistent innovation in sectors such as technology, entertainment, and agriculture. Home to some of the world's leading companies, California steadily pushes the boundaries of what's possible. However, the state consistently confronts significant hindrances, including a high cost of living, endemic income inequality, and growing environmental concerns. In light of these difficulties, California remains a land of unparalleled opportunity, with a proactive approach to addressing its obstacles.
California's Schools: Triumphs and Challenges
California's education system is a dynamic entity with both notable successes and areas needing improvement. On the positive side, the state boasts celebrated universities like UC Berkeley and Stanford, consistently ranking among the best in the world. Additionally, California has made advancements in funding for schools, though disparities remain between wealthy and under-resourced districts. A key area for improvement is addressing the issue of educational inequality, ensuring that all students have access to a quality education regardless of their background or zip code.
To further enhance the system, California needs to dedicate more resources to preschool programs. Expanding access to affordable childcare would allow parents to work and contribute to the economy while ensuring their children receive a strong foundation for future learning. Furthermore, addressing teacher shortages remain critical challenges. California must offer competitive salaries and benefits to recruit talented educators and preserve experienced professionals in the classroom.
Finally, integrating digital tools into classrooms effectively can enhance student learning experiences. Providing teachers with professional development opportunities and ensuring equitable access to technology for all students are essential steps in this direction.
Exploring the Diverse Landscapes of California
California is a state renowned for its breathtakingly diverse landscapes. From rugged mountain ranges to sparkling coastal waters, there's a landscape for every type of traveler. Venture into the picturesque redwood forests of the North California, where giant trees reach for the azure sky. To the south, the sun-drenched deserts of Mojave offer a immense and otherworldly experience. And don't forget the legendary Yosemite National Park, home to grand granite cliffs, crystalline waterfalls, and thriving wildlife.
